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the drainage issue can significantly impact the cost. Minor repairs will be less expensive than major overhauls.
- Type of Drainage System: Different systems, such as French drains or surface drains, have varying costs associated with installation and repair.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used for repairs can affect the overall cost. Higher-quality materials usually come at a higher price.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Bear, DE, can vary. Experienced professionals may charge more for their expertise.
- Accessibility: The ease of accessing the drainage area can influence the cost. Hard-to-reach areas may require more time and specialized equipment.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Bear, DE) |
---|---|
Initial Inspection | $100 - $200 |
Minor Drainage Repair | $300 - $600 |
French Drain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Surface Drain Installation | $800 - $1,500 |
Downspout Extension | $150 - $300 |
Sump Pump Installation |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Waterproofing | $500 - $1,200 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$150 |
Follow-up Inspection | $50 - $100 |
